Why Proximity Sensors Are Non-Negotiable for Commercial Buses

At their core, proximity sensors are simple in concept but profound in impact: they detect objects (or people) within a certain range of the bus and alert the driver—often through beeps, lights, or vibrations—before a collision occurs. For commercial buses, this isn't just about convenience; it's about saving lives. Consider the numbers: according to the National Highway Traffic Safety Administration (NHTSA), buses are involved in over 13,000 accidents annually in the U.S. alone, many of which stem from blind spots or limited visibility during maneuvers like reversing, turning, or parking. Proximity sensors slash these risks by providing real-time data, even when the driver's eyes are focused elsewhere.

A Closer Look: The Types of Proximity Sensors Powering Bus Safety

Proximity sensors come in various forms, each designed to tackle specific challenges. For commercial buses, three types stand out for their reliability and effectiveness. Let's break them down:

Sensor Type How It Works Best For Key Advantages Considerations
Ultrasonic Sensors Emits high-frequency sound waves (inaudible to humans) and measures the time it takes for waves to bounce back from objects. Short-range detection (1-5 meters), ideal for parking, reversing, or tight turns. Cost-effective, works in most weather conditions, easy to install. May struggle with very soft objects (e.g., thick snow) that absorb sound waves.
Microwave Sensors (79GHz) Uses radio waves to detect moving or stationary objects, even at longer distances. Blind spot monitoring, lane change alerts, or detecting fast-approaching vehicles. Longer range (up to 30 meters), unaffected by weather (rain, fog, snow), high accuracy. Slightly higher cost than ultrasonic; requires calibration for bus size.
Infrared Sensors Detects infrared radiation (heat) emitted by living beings or warm objects. Pedestrian detection near bus doors or in crowded areas. Instant alerts for living objects, low power consumption. Less effective in extreme temperatures; may false-alarm near hot engine parts.

For most commercial bus fleets, a hybrid approach works best: ultrasonic sensors for parking and reversing, paired with microwave sensors (like the 79GHz models) for blind spot detection. This combination ensures 360-degree coverage, leaving no gap in safety. Beyond Sensors: Integrating Proximity Tech with AI for Next-Level Safety

Proximity sensors are powerful on their own, but when paired with artificial intelligence (AI), they become transformative. Take AI BSD blind spot detection systems , for example. Traditional blind spot monitors alert drivers to objects in their blind spots—but AI-powered systems take it further. They can distinguish between a stationary lamppost and a moving cyclist, prioritize alerts based on threat level (a child running is more urgent than a parked car), and even predict potential collisions, giving drivers extra seconds to react.

For commercial buses, this integration is a game-changer. Imagine a bus making a right turn: the AI BSD system, working with proximity sensors, detects a cyclist in the blind spot, flashes a warning light on the dashboard, and sounds a distinct alert—all before the driver even starts turning. Or consider a bus reversing at a depot: ultrasonic sensors detect a maintenance worker walking behind, while the AI system recognizes the human shape and triggers an immediate stop, even if the driver doesn't hit the brakes.
